Hi Paul,
This patch set consists of enhancement of fcvextract.pl,
update of snippets in datastruct, and some minor tweaks.
fcvextract.pl now suppresses comment blocks in C source and
supports alternative code for snippets in #ifndef blocks,
which won't be affected by the suppression of comment blocks.
Also, labeling of the form /* \lnlbl{label} */ is now supported
in C snippets.
Patch #1 adds comment block handling to fcvextract.pl, without
changing the default behavior.
Patch #2 adds a couple of explicit options to snippets which
have comments to be displayed. It also converts alternative
code fragments using "#ifndef FCV_EXCLUDE" so that they survive
comment block suppression.
Patch #3 changes the default to "keepcomment=no".
This removes a couple of comments in Listings 4.8 and 9.5.
Patch #4 removes now redundant "\fcvexclude" around comment
blocks. It also uses "#ifndef FCV_SNIPPET" to reduce \fcvexclude
uses.
Patch #5 adds support of "/* \lnlbl{label} */" labeling.
Patch #6 updates snippets of hash_bkt.c. "struct hashtab"
now has the "ht_cmp" field and I updated the text to mention
it. You might want to do some rewording.
Patch #7 adds the "ht_cmp" field in the hashdiagram figure
(still in .fig).
Patch #8 updates the rest of snippets in datastruct. It also
fixes typo in cross references of Listing 10.13.
By this change, an smp_mb() appears in ht_get_bucket()
(Listing 10.10).
My guess is that the counterpart barrier is the first
synchronize_rcu() in hashtab_resize(). It might deserve some
explanation or a Quick Quiz. Also, Answer to Quick Quiz 10.13
might need some expansion, since it looks as though hash_reorder.c
used something more than the pure RCU protection. But I might be
completely misreading here...
Patches #9 and #10 are minor tweaks in appearance of
Listing 10.13. As you can see, tab-space width can be
adjusted per snippet.
Patch #11 permits more chances of hyphenation.
I'm thinking of globally widening tab space of snippets for
1C layout. Let me do some experiment.
